A flint pick was recovered from 'Rectory Field' at an unspedified date. ' Rectory field' may refer to thefield marked as 'Vicarage Pightle' at this grid reference. The pick is held by NCM. It had previously been held as part of the Apling Collection, and before that as Sainty green 128. This pick may be the same find as the 'slug plane' described in (S1) as being found by Sainty 'near Ringland Vicarage.'
